Building Your Success with a Concrete Block Making Business Plan PDF

A well-crafted Concrete Block Making Business Plan Pdf does more than outline operations; it aligns vision with actionable steps grounded in market realities. Starting with a detailed executive summary, the plan captures the essence of the venture: producing high-quality concrete blocks that meet structural demands across residential, commercial, and infrastructure projects. This document becomes the heartbeat of decision-making, investor pitches, and daily management. To construct this vital roadmap, begin with a thorough market analysis. Identify regional demand patterns—assess construction booms, government infrastructure programs, and competition from existing block makers. Understanding customer preferences ensures product design matches real needs: size standards, compressive strength requirements, and eco-friendly formulations increasingly shape buyer loyalty. This insight shapes both production capacity and marketing strategy embedded in the plan’s core sections. Next, technical specifications must reflect modern manufacturing precision. Outline equipment needs: formers, curing systems, automated mixers—each impacting output efficiency and cost structure. Detail raw material sourcing strategies: cement quality control is non-negotiable for durability; aggregates must be durable and locally accessible to minimize logistics costs. Integrating sustainability practices—recycling industrial byproducts or using alternative fuels—positions the business as forward-thinking while complying with evolving regulations. Financial planning forms the backbone of credibility in any business plan PDF. Project startup costs including machinery acquisition, facility setup, labor training, and working capital reserves. Project revenue through volume-based pricing models tailored to local contractors and developers. Break-even analysis clarifies when profitability begins—typically within 12 to 18 months assuming steady demand—and forecasts gross margins adjusted for inflationary pressures on cement prices. Include sensitivity analyses testing scenarios like supply chain disruptions or sudden market downturns to demonstrate resilience planning. Operational workflows deserve equal attention within the document. Map daily processes from mixing batch schedules to curing timelines—each step optimized for throughput without compromising quality benchmarks set by industry codes such as ASTM or local building standards. Implement quality control checkpoints after every production cycle to ensure consistency; these protocols build trust with clients who rely on reliable material performance under stress conditions like heavy loads or weather extremes. Marketing strategy section elevates visibility beyond production lines. Define branding elements emphasizing reliability and innovation—critical differentiators in competitive markets where trust drives long-term contracts. Leverage digital channels: create an online catalog showcasing product specs and client testimonials; engage local builders via trade shows and referral networks to build community partnerships that fuel steady orders without heavy ad spend dependency typical in traditional media campaigns. Supply chain robustness cannot be overlooked in this business plan PDF foundation. Establish relationships with dependable cement suppliers while exploring bulk purchasing agreements to reduce unit costs during high-volume production phases. Secure consistent access to clean water sources essential for mixing; factor storage facilities that prevent material degradation during extended downtime periods caused by logistics delays or seasonal challenges affecting transport routes. Risk management remains integral throughout all stages of execution outlined here. Identify potential threats: fluctuating raw material costs due to global commodity shifts; regulatory changes imposing stricter environmental compliance; labor shortages requiring proactive recruitment strategies including training programs that boost retention rates over timeframes exceeding six months post-launch phase initiation. Anticipating these allows mitigation tactics like hedging against price spikes through fixed-price supplier contracts or cross-training workers for multi-functional roles that maintain productivity even when staffing levels vary unexpectedly.
